Yahoo! recommends YUI 3. Learn about YUI 3 on YUILibrary.com.
The ProfilerViewer Control can be easily internationalized by modifying the STRINGS member of YAHOO.widget.ProfilerViewer In this example, a German translation provided by Christian Heilmann is applied to the UI.
Customizing the ProfilerViewer UI for non-English languages is easy. In the example below, we've applied a German translation provided by Christian Heilmann to the ProfilerViewer.
This example has the following dependencies:
All of the interface's language strings live in the static member YAHOO.widget.ProfilerViewer.STRINGS. Customizing the interface simply involves modifying or replacing that object prior to creating your ProfilerViewer instance.
All YUI 2.x users should review the YUI 2.8.2 security bulletin, which discusses a vulnerability present in YUI 2.4.0-2.8.1.

Copyright © 2013 Yahoo! Inc. All rights reserved.